• Middletown police officer alleges discrimination

    Township attorney cites internal politics, not discrimination BY ANDREW DAVISON Staff Writer A lawsuit filed on behalf of a Middletown Township police officer is seeking to have the court appoint a monitor to institute anti-discrimination policies and regulations within the Middletown Police Department. The complaint, filed on behalf of Middletown Police Officer Darrin D. Simon,…

  • Matawan to restrict use of boro vehicles

    Council to vote on ending take-home privileges for most employees on June 21 BY DANIEL HOWLEY MATAWAN — With fuel prices at just under $4 a gallon, the Matawan Borough Council is mulling a proposal to restrict take-home use of municipal vehicles by borough employees. The measure would bar employees from taking home municipal vehicles.…

  • Holmdel to host NJ International Track and Field Meet on June 18

    The 25th annual New Jersey International Track and Field Meet is set for June 18 at Bob Roggy Memorial Field at Holmdel High School, Holmdel. The meet will run 4-9 p.m. With the USA Track and Field Outdoor National Championships coming up, elite athletes will be looking to post qualifying marks to compete at the…

  • sport shorts 

    The Jackson Renegades Fastpitch Softball Organization will conduct a Jackson summer softball camp during the week of June 27. The four-day camp will be held at the Bartley Road softball complex on Bartley Road, Jackson, across from the Holbrook Little League. The clinic will be held 6-8 p.m. June 27, 28, 30 and July 1.…
